there are often netizen speculations about when a drama is fully filmed and edited on weibo, however a wait time of 6 months can extend to three years because of strict censorship (ex. Oath of Love) even if a drama has been fully filmed it can have random episodes deemed "inappropriate" according to policy removed or have the show cancelled

the reason for dubbing is because the character's expected voice can't be matched by the actor/actress' real voice. dilireba is considered to have "奶音“ which means her voice has a "creamy" vibe and cant match a brave heroine. it's possible she has been able to develop a more diverse vocal range, however lack of original dubbing can also be due to a celeb's busy schedule. hope this helps! the whole concept is foreign to many other countries so it is understandably confusing and odd
